Bamidbar 5:4-9 Orthodox Jewish Bible (OJB)

4. And the Bnei Yisroel did so, and put them outside the machaneh; just as Hashem spoke unto Moshe, so did the Bnei Yisroel.

5. And Hashem spoke unto Moshe, saying,

6. Speak unto the Bnei Yisroel, When a man or woman shall commit any chattot that men commit, l'me'ol ma'al baHashem (thereby trespassing against Hashem), and feels guilty;

7. Then they shall make vidduy (confession of sin) of their chattot which they have committed; and shall make reparation in full, and add unto it the fifth part thereof, and give it unto him against whom they hath incurred liability.

8. But if the man have no go'el unto whom reparation for the asham can be made, let the asham be recompensed unto Hashem, even to the kohen, besides the ram of the kippurim, whereby a kapparah shall be made on his behalf.

9. And every terumah of all the holy things of the Bnei Yisroel, which they bring unto the kohen, shall be his.
